1. Levels of Electric Vehicle Charging
Electric vehicle charging is arranged into three primary
levels, each offering different charging speeds:
Level 1 (120V AC): This is the slowest charging level and is
normally done utilizing a standard family outlet. Level 1 charging is helpful
for short-term charging yet may consume a large chunk of the day to charge the
battery, frequently around 8-12 hours for a regular EV completely.
Level 2 (240V AC): Level 2 charging is the most well-known
for home charging stations and public charging stations. It is altogether
quicker than Level 1 charging, presenting around 20-60 miles of reach each hour
of charging, contingent upon the EV and the charging station's power yield. A
Level 2 charger can completely charge most EVs in 4-8 hours.
Level 3 (DC Quick Charging): DC quick charging is the
speediest choice, giving high-power DC (direct current) to the vehicle's
battery. Charging times are typically estimated in minutes as opposed to hours.
DC quick charging stations are normally found along parkways and in
metropolitan regions, making really long travel more advantageous for EV
proprietors.
2. Sorts of Charging Connectors
The decision of charging connector relies upon the EV make
and model. A few connector types are utilized all over the planet. The most
well-known ones include:
SAE J1772 (Type 1): This is a standard connector utilized
primarily in North America for Level 1 and Level 2 charging. It is moderately
sluggish contrasted with a few different connectors yet is generally upheld.
Mennekes (Type 2): The Mennekes connector is generally
utilized in Europe and is likewise utilized for Level 1 and Level 2 charging.
It is known for its security highlights and adaptability.
CCS (Consolidated Charging Framework): CCS is a connector
that joins the standard J1772 plug with extra pins for DC quick charging. It is
generally utilized in North America and Europe for quick charging.
CHAdeMO: This connector was created in Japan and is
generally utilized for DC quick charging, particularly for Nissan and a few
other Asian automakers' vehicles.
Tesla Supercharger: Tesla has its restrictive quick charging
network utilizing an exceptional connector. Nonetheless, Tesla vehicles are
additionally outfitted with a connector that permits them to utilize Level 2
accusing stations of J1772 connectors.
3. Charging Foundation
EV charging foundation is extending quickly, with charging
stations accessible in different areas, including public spaces, parking areas,
working environments, and, surprisingly, confidential homes. Here are a few
vital parts of the charging framework:
Public Charging Stations: Public charging stations are much
of the time situated in metropolitan regions, retail plazas, eateries, and
along parkways. They give Level 2 and DC quick charging choices, permitting EV
proprietors to charge their vehicles while shopping or on lengthy outings.
Work environment Charging: Numerous businesses are
introducing EV charging stations in their working environments to urge
representatives to drive electric. Working environment charging is ordinarily
Level 2 and can give helpful day to day charging.
Home Charging Stations: Home charging is the most well-known
way for EV proprietors to charge their vehicles. Numerous EV proprietors
introduce Level 2 chargers at their homes, which give a quicker and more
helpful charging arrangement than Level 1.
EV Charging Applications: A few applications and sites give
data about the areas of charging stations, their accessibility, and frequently
constant updates on charging status. Well known applications incorporate
PlugShare, ChargePoint, and Zap America.
4. Charging Your Electric Vehicle at Home
Charging your electric vehicle at home is helpful and can be
a practical method for keeping your EV charged. This is the carefully guarded
secret:
Buy a Home Charging Station: To charge your EV at home,
you'll require a Level 2 home charging station, frequently called Electric
Vehicle Administration Hardware (EVSE). These stations can be bought from
different producers and are regularly designed into your electrical board or
associated through a devoted NEMA 14-50 outlet.
Establishment: It's fundamental to have a certified
electrical technician introduce the home charging station, it is appropriately
wired and grounded to guarantee that it. The establishment cost might fluctuate
relying upon your electrical board's area and limit.
Charging Interaction: When the home charging station is
introduced, essentially plug your EV into the station utilizing the suitable
connector. The accusing station conveys of your EV to give the right power
level, and the charging system starts. You can set the charging time and charge
limit through the station or a versatile application, whenever upheld.
Charging Time: Level 2 home charging stations can completely
charge most EVs in 4-8 hours, contingent upon the vehicle's battery limit and
the station's power yield. Charging time can shift, so counseling your EV's client
manual for explicit details is fundamental.
5. Charging Your Electric Vehicle Out and about
Charging your electric vehicle out and about is an alternate
encounter and frequently includes utilizing public charging stations. This is
the secret:
Find a Charging Station: Utilize an EV charging application
or a route framework to find a close by open charging station. Many charging
stations are situated in helpful places, for example, malls, expressway rest
regions, or close to well known objections.
Plug In: When you show up at the charging station, select
the fitting connector and fitting it into your EV. Numerous public charging
stations support different connector types to oblige different EV models.
Installment: Most open charging stations require installment
for the power you use. Installment can be made through different techniques,
including RFID cards, versatile applications, or Visas. The expense of charging
may change relying upon the station and area.
Charging Time: Charging time at a public station relies upon
the charging level (Level 2 or DC quick charging) and your vehicle's battery
limit. Level 2 charging normally requires a couple of hours, while DC quick
charging can give a huge reach help in under 60 minutes.
Separate and Proceed: When your EV is charged to your ideal
level, disengage the charging link and proceed with your excursion. Numerous
public stations likewise have an effortlessness period for you to move your
vehicle in the wake of charging is finished to permit other EV proprietors admittance
to the station.
